James Irven Bowers Jr.

March 8, 2022

James Irven Bowers, Jr., age 84, of Lascassas, passed away March 8, 2022 at his residence. He was a native and life-long resident of Rutherford County. He retired from Midsouth Bus (formerly Blue Bird) of Tennessee in 2002 after 30 years of service. He also owned and operated bus 85 for many years. But, his great love in life was farming. He was a member of Northfield Boulevard Church of Christ where he served as a deacon. He was a man who loved his family and his church family. He had a good understanding of electricity and as well as skill in repairing just about any thing. Time and memories with his family were of great value to him. But above all he loved the Lord. He was preceded in death by his parents, James Irven Bowers, Sr. and Winnie Leeman Bowers; sister, Helen Johnson and a brother, Everette Bowers. He is survived by his wife of 60 years, Betty Heaton Bowers; daughters, Roffee (Mike) Lamb and Jullee Bailey; sisters, Jean Jamison and Ruby (John) Massey and brother, Robert Bowers; grandchildren, Brad Lamb, Michael (Catlyn) Lamb, Neal Bailey, Jeannie Beth (Tommy) Griffith, and Andrew (Megan) Lamb, Greg Lamb, and Timothy Lamb; great-grandchildren, Addison Lamb and Eli Griffith. Visitation will be 4:00-7:00 PM, Friday, March 11, 2022 at Jennings and Ayers Funeral Home. Chapel service will be 1:00 PM, Saturday, March 12, 2022 at Jennings and Ayers Funeral Home with David Bunting and Mike Lamb officiating. Burial will follow in Roselawn Memorial Gardens with grandsons serving as pallbearers. Jennings and Ayers Funeral Home and Cremation Services, 820 S.
